Course Description

Python Programming MOOC 2022: A Comprehensive Introduction to Python Programming Python is a high-level, interpreted programming language that has rapidly gained popularity due to its simplicity, versatility, and readability. Python is widely used in various fields, including data science, machine learning, web development, and scientific computing. Python is an excellent language for beginners due to its straightforward syntax and ease of learning. Python Programming MOOC 2022 is a comprehensive online course that will teach you how to code in Python from scratch. This course is designed to introduce you to the basics of Python programming and gradually guide you through the language's advanced features. The course is self-paced, meaning that you can learn at your own pace and from anywhere in the world. The course is structured in a modular format, and each module contains video lectures, practical examples, and interactive exercises. Python Programming MOOC 2022 covers a wide range of topics, starting with the basics of Python syntax, data types, and control structures. You will learn how to write Python programs that read and write files, handle exceptions, and work with regular expressions. You will also learn about Python libraries such as NumPy, Pandas, and Matplotlib, which are used for data analysis and visualization. The course also covers advanced topics such as object-oriented programming, algorithms, data structures, and machine learning. You will learn how to write Python programs that implement different algorithms such as sorting, searching, and graph algorithms. You will also learn about different data structures such as arrays, linked lists, stacks, and queues. Python Programming MOOC 2022 is suitable for anyone who wants to learn Python programming, regardless of their prior programming experience. The course is designed for beginners, but it also covers advanced topics that will be of interest to experienced programmers. The course is ideal for anyone who wants to pursue a career in data science, machine learning, or scientific computing. In conclusion, Python Programming MOOC 2022 is a comprehensive online course that provides a thorough introduction to Python programming. The course is designed to be accessible and engaging, with interactive exercises and practical examples that will help you develop your programming skills. Whether you are a beginner or an experienced programmer, this course is an excellent way to learn Python and take your programming skills to the next level. Author: University of Helsinki